Transaction fa93d59dfceb718688063d8e17da3ae7769c6732a6629c1daa4904266f2a5a1d

1 Input
2 Outputs
  • fa93d59dfceb718688063d8e17da3ae7769c6732a6629c1daa4904266f2a5a1d:0
  • value  1015625
    address  mtTZB22mbLCpxdJQvwSF7Cw7ozWoCNTTch
  • fa93d59dfceb718688063d8e17da3ae7769c6732a6629c1daa4904266f2a5a1d:1
  • value  85916518972
    address  2N42iVEDyppS6RmkzjQGDmfvY8SeJraDNFJ